This was a great compilation of the LA band The Dils which we licensed from Lost Records who did the vinyl version. This has 29 tracks, 13 more than the LP
4 Track EP, first 500 on Pink vinyl, next 500 on Black. This four tracks EP was recorded live in 1977, just before their “Bend & Flush” single was released. The sound quality is a little poor and the vocals are rather low in the mix.
